Title: New Campus Housing Policy


In an effort to enhance the on-campus living experience, the university administration has recently implemented a new campus housing policy. The policy aims to address the increasing demand for student housing and provide better accommodation options for students. Under the new policy, several changes have been made to the existing housing system.


Firstly, the university has constructed a state-of-the-art residence hall that offers modern amenities and spacious rooms. This new facility will accommodate a significant number of students and reduce the burden on existing dormitories. Moreover, the administration has also renovated existing residence halls, upgrading facilities such as study lounges, laundry rooms, and communal spaces, to create a more comfortable and conducive living environment.


Additionally, the policy introduces a revised housing assignment process. In the past, housing assignments were primarily based on a first-come, first-served basis. However, under the new policy, a lottery system will be implemented, ensuring a fair distribution of rooms among all eligible students. This change aims to eliminate any unfair advantages and provide equal opportunities for students to secure desirable housing options.


Furthermore, the new policy allows students to form roommate groups during the room selection process. This gives students the flexibility to choose their roommates and live with individuals who have similar lifestyles or academic interests. Research has shown that living with compatible roommates positively impacts students' overall well-being and academic success.


Overall, the new campus housing policy represents a significant step forward in enhancing the on-campus living experience. It provides students with improved accommodation options, a fair room assignment process, and the opportunity to select compatible roommates, thereby fostering a more positive and engaging living environment.

Technology has significantly influenced various aspects of society, including the field of education. In recent years, there has been a rapid integration of technology into classrooms worldwide, revolutionizing traditional teaching methods and enhancing learning experiences. This passage explores the role of technology in education, its benefits, and potential challenges.


One of the primary advantages of technology in education is the access it provides to a vast array of information. With the internet and digital resources, students can effortlessly access up-to-date information, conduct research, and explore diverse perspectives on any given topic. This availability of information helps foster critical thinking skills and promotes independent learning.


Furthermore, technology has opened up new avenues for collaboration and interaction among students and educators. Online platforms and communication tools enable seamless communication, even across geographical boundaries. Students can engage in virtual group projects, participate in online discussions, and receive immediate feedback from their peers and instructors.


However, integrating technology in education is not without challenges. One concern is the potential distraction caused by excessive screen time. It is crucial to strike a balance between using technology as a tool for learning and ensuring that it does not hinder students' focus and attention spans. Additionally, there is a digital divide that exists, where students from economically disadvantaged backgrounds may have limited access to technology and internet connectivity, creating disparities in educational opportunities.


Overall, technology has the potential to transform education by providing access to information, facilitating collaboration, and fostering innovative teaching methods. However, it is essential to address the challenges associated with its integration to ensure equitable access and maximize its benefits for all students.

Lecturer: Today, we're going to discuss the importance of urban planning in creating sustainable cities. Urban planners play a crucial role in designing cities that are environmentally friendly, socially equitable, and economically viable. One of the key aspects of sustainable urban planning is the incorporation of green spaces throughout the city. Green spaces, such as parks and gardens, provide numerous benefits to both the environment and the residents.



Student: How exactly do green spaces contribute to sustainability?



Lecturer: Great question! Green spaces offer several environmental advantages. They help combat urban heat islands by reducing the temperature in densely built areas. Trees and vegetation in parks act as natural air filters, improving air quality and reducing pollution. Additionally, green spaces promote biodiversity by providing habitats for various species of plants and animals.



Student: That's fascinating! So, apart from the environmental benefits, do green spaces have any social or economic advantages?



Lecturer: Absolutely! Green spaces have significant social benefits as well. They provide opportunities for recreational activities, exercise, and relaxation, which contribute to the overall well-being of the residents. Parks serve as communal gathering places, fostering a sense of community and social interaction. Moreover, research has shown that access to green spaces improves mental health and reduces stress levels.



Student: And what about the economic aspects?



Lecturer: Green spaces also have economic advantages. They enhance property values in surrounding areas, making them more attractive to residents and investors. Parks and gardens can boost tourism, attracting visitors and generating revenue for the local economy. Additionally, green infrastructure, such as sustainable drainage systems and rooftop gardens, can contribute to energy efficiency and reduce maintenance costs in the long run.



Student: Thank you for explaining the significance of green spaces in sustainable urban planning. It's clear that they provide numerous benefits for both the environment and the community.



Lecturer: You're welcome! It's crucial for urban planners to prioritize the integration of green spaces into their designs to create livable and sustainable cities.
